Role

This is a newly created position to act as number 2 for the Head of Finance. The role will include overseeing the daily financial operations of a multi-site business and will be based at the Hull office although some travel will be required occasionally.

Responsibilities

  • Manage and support a finance team including two managers ensuring strong financial control and compliance
  • Lead the month-end close, balance sheet reviews and financial reporting processes
  • Provide leadership and development to the finance team and have the ability to drive process improvements and standardisation
  • Business partnering right across the business with both finance and non-finance colleagues

Candidate Qualifications

  • Fully qualified ACA/ACCA/CIMA finance professional who has already held a senior accounting role including the management of a team
  • Effective leader who brings out the best in people and can liaise effectively across a business
  • Collaborative, investigative and technically adept with exceptional communication skills
  • Highly systems literate and able to undertake some occasional travel as part of the role
  • Previous experience as a Financial Controller beneficial
